Beijing gets hot in summer … very hot! What better way to cool down than with a stroll down a river?

The White River is one of the rivers that feed the big Miyun Reservoir, and the river winds its way down a long canyon with dramatic cliffs and outcrops.

We had blue skies and hot weather on this walk – perfect!
